Encore: TELLTALE HEARTS – HOW THE PATIENT'S STORY UNLOCKS HEALING

from Psych Up Live

This Show offers a powerful and eye-opening consideration of medical care for marginalized people. Whether from a patient's perspective or the perspective of those who serve as medical caregivers, you will find Dr. Dean David Schillinger's TELLTALE HEARTS to be an extraordinary book and Dr. Schillinger to be an extraordinary person. What Dr. Schillinger offers is the gift of his own story in tandem with the unexpected, tragic, impressive and heart-breaking stories of his patients. Both sets of stories offer a glimpse of how industrialized medical systems can be dangerous for patients who are misunderstood, stereotyped and overlooked and for doctors who are struggling with burn-out, bias and at times frustration and despair. What Dr. Schillinger believes, and shares is the power of the patient's narrative. He exemplifies that when a patient is invited to be known, to tell their story, to be seen and respected– treatment and healing often become possible. Dr. Schillinger's description of his journey and his relationship with patients who dare to share and be known is medically and socially invaluable.
